The beauty of Tehachapi is seen in every setting. The diversity of the area offers something for everyone, small town neighborhoods, mountains filled with oak and pine trees sheltering the most rustic to the most luxurious homes, sprawling ranches and everything in between, all beautifully displayed in the splendor of four wonderfully distinct seasons. We highly recommend visiting one of the many wineries or breweries, buy organic produce and free range eggs from the local farmers market. Visit the Glider Airport and see how NASA pilots would come and learn how to land the Space Shuttle - you can even co-pilot a glider if you wanted! Mountain bike or hike on the many trails in the Tehachapi Mountain Park and the Pacific Crest Trail. Walk to downtown to enjoy one of the abundant restaurants. This house is off grid at 5400 feet in Alpine forest 20 mins from Downtown Tehachapi. Very secluded and private. Lots of wildlife to see from birds to dear and bucks. You may see Bobcats and Black Bears too. And the condors come in seasonally. Mountain lions have been spotted as well so keep you eyes open and leash up your pets.
Alpine Forest has four seasons and we are on well maintained dirt roads. I drive my 328i BMW up here all the time without problems. But it does snow now and then in the winter so you may need chains or four wheel drive but we have a jeep truck and will get you safely up and down the mountain if needed.
